Transaction 3ada1576e51481b825184381ad114806ef507a5a824f3c8ae4f3cc25746687f1

2 Input
2 Outputs
  • 3ada1576e51481b825184381ad114806ef507a5a824f3c8ae4f3cc25746687f1:0
  • value  2700508
    address  388an2p6Qdt2osCL1AewXxBRbuqk57hZjK
  • 3ada1576e51481b825184381ad114806ef507a5a824f3c8ae4f3cc25746687f1:1
  • value  755
    address  1KszfJcwvCV5KJnmN6eL27GoTZw2QfVm6w